Transaction 667d6c3166ca8b845f0a4c1ab8bc47894a174a2615a65a05b1e1ffbc98217844
1 Input
1 Output
-
667d6c3166ca8b845f0a4c1ab8bc47894a174a2615a65a05b1e1ffbc98217844:0
- value
- 39956
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 384c7e6c75a2bf765155c2bcdfaadf4937923b7f OP_EQUAL
- address
- 36phQAuYNp7MAAqAQPxWzfpbWVq5xANG2a